Airline Route Expansion and Service Update for 2025
American Airlines
- Chicago O’Hare (ORD) to Naples (NAP): Daily non-stop flights starting May 6, 20251.
- Dallas/Fort Worth (DFW) to Venice (VCE): New route launching on June 5, 20251.
- Miami (MIA) to Rome–Fiumicino (FCO): Route moved up to start on June 5, 2025, instead of July1.
- Resumption of flights to Edinburgh (EDI): After a hiatus since 20191.
- New routes to Athens (ATH), Madrid (MAD), and Milan (MXP): Part of the airline’s European expansion1.

Aer Lingus
- Dublin (DUB) to Nashville (BNA): Four weekly non-stop flights starting April 12, 20251.
Air Canada
- Montreal to Naples (NAP) and Porto (OPO): New routes25.
- Toronto to Prague (PRG) and Port of Spain (POS): Resumption of services25.
- Ottawa to London Heathrow (LHR): New route25.
- Vancouver to Nashville (BNA) and Montreal to Cincinnati (CVG): New transborder routes25.
- Resumption of service from Toronto to Jacksonville (JAX): Only non-stop service between Canada and Jacksonville25.
- Increased frequencies to Rome (FCO), Athens (ATH), Indianapolis (IND), Boston (BOS), Tampa (TPA), and Dallas-Fort Worth (DFW): Additional daily flights from various Canadian cities25.
- Resumption of summer seasonal service to Seoul (ICN) from Montreal and Osaka (KIX) from Toronto: On Boeing 787 Dreamliner aircraft25.

Delta Air Lines
- New York (JFK) to Catania (CTA): First-ever non-stop service from the U.S. to Catania, starting in May 20251.
- New routes to Barcelona (BCN), Dublin (DUB), and Brussels (BRU): Part of the airline’s European expansion1.
- Minneapolis-St. Paul (MSP) to Copenhagen (CPH): New route1.
- Relaunch of Los Angeles (LAX) to Shanghai (PVG) service1.
- New domestic routes from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) to Panama City (ECP), Indianapolis (IND), Memphis (MEM), San Francisco (SFO), and Tampa (TPA): Starting in spring 20251.
